Output 3db3640b6a0c39ec24353ba949a0f6d6efe5f0d28183c328a07e05d406211e3b:1

value
23332507
script pubkey
OP_HASH160 OP_PUSHBYTES_20 16331678c5b12ef44539e74638ff64da38e13dae OP_EQUAL
address
33iPzQTSxPaXm43VGREdmv6KQcdggLgNLq
transaction
3db3640b6a0c39ec24353ba949a0f6d6efe5f0d28183c328a07e05d406211e3b
confirmations
375756
spent
true